Maria Theresa was the ruler of the Habsburg Empire and Frederick II was the ruler of Prussia. They were both powerful monarchs in Europe during the 18th century and had a complex relationship. Maria Theresa and Frederick II were adversaries in the War of Austrian Succession and the Seven Years' War, but they also had periods of cooperation and mutual respect. Their rivalry shaped the politics of Europe during their reigns, with Maria Theresa ultimately seeking to push back against Frederick's expansionist ambitions. Despite their differences, the two monarchs had a lasting impact on the history of Europe during their reigns.
